114
115 /* Implements a minimalistic AT commands parser that echo input back and
116  * reply with 'OK' to each input command. See AT command protocol details in the
117  * ITU-T V.250 recomendations document.
118  *
119  * Be aware that this processor is not fully V.250 compliant.
120  */
121 static int wwan_hwsim_port_tx(struct wwan_port *wport, struct sk_buff *in)
122 {
123         struct wwan_hwsim_port *port = wwan_port_get_drvdata(wport);
124         struct sk_buff *out;
125         int i, n, s;
126
127         /* Estimate a max possible number of commands by counting the number of
128          * termination chars (S3 param, CR by default). And then allocate the
129          * output buffer that will be enough to fit the echo and result codes of
130          * all commands.
131          */
132         for (i = 0, n = 0; i < in->len; ++i)
133                 if (in->data[i] == '\r')
134                         n++;
135         n = in->len + n * (2 + 2 + 2);  /* Output buffer size */
136         out = alloc_skb(n, GFP_KERNEL);
137         if (!out)
138                 return -ENOMEM;
139
140         for (i = 0, s = 0; i < in->len; ++i) {
141                 char c = in->data[i];
142
143                 if (port->pstate == AT_PARSER_WAIT_A) {
144                         if (c == 'A' || c == 'a')
145                                 port->pstate = AT_PARSER_WAIT_T;
146                         else if (c != '\n')     /* Ignore formating char */
147                                 port->pstate = AT_PARSER_SKIP_LINE;
148                 } else if (port->pstate == AT_PARSER_WAIT_T) {
149                         if (c == 'T' || c == 't')
150                                 port->pstate = AT_PARSER_WAIT_TERM;
151                         else
152                                 port->pstate = AT_PARSER_SKIP_LINE;
153                 } else if (port->pstate == AT_PARSER_WAIT_TERM) {
154                         if (c != '\r')
155                                 continue;
156                         /* Consume the trailing formatting char as well */
157                         if ((i + 1) < in->len && in->data[i + 1] == '\n')
158                                 i++;
159                         n = i - s + 1;
160                         skb_put_data(out, &in->data[s], n);/* Echo */
161                         skb_put_data(out, "\r\nOK\r\n", 6);
162                         s = i + 1;
163                         port->pstate = AT_PARSER_WAIT_A;
164                 } else if (port->pstate == AT_PARSER_SKIP_LINE) {
165                         if (c != '\r')
166                                 continue;
167                         port->pstate = AT_PARSER_WAIT_A;
168                 }
169         }
170
171         if (i > s) {
172                 /* Echo the processed portion of a not yet completed command */
173                 n = i - s;
174                 skb_put_data(out, &in->data[s], n);
175         }
176
177         consume_skb(in);
178
179         wwan_port_rx(wport, out);
180
181         return 0;
182 }
